The pattern shows up clearly in famous December 15 birthdays. Gustave Eiffel, born in 1832, designed the Eiffel Tower and the iron skeleton inside the Statue of Liberty. Oscar Niemeyer, born in 1907, designed many of the public buildings of Brasilia and worked actively as an architect into his hundredth year. J. Paul Getty, born in 1892, built one of the largest oil fortunes of the twentieth century and founded the Getty Museum. Tim Conway, born in 1933, won six Emmy Awards for The Carol Burnett Show with quiet, steady comedic craft. Maurice Wilkins, born in 1916, shared the 1962 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ine for his work on the structure of DNA. Different fields, same chart pattern.

The Three Sagittarius Decans
Each Western sign spans 30 degrees, divided into three 10-degree decans with their own classical sub-ruler. Your decan adds nuance to the broader Sagittarius archetype.
- Decan 1Days 1–10Sub-ruler: Jupiter
Pure Sagittarius. Optimistic, expansive, truth-seeking.
- Decan 2Days 11–20Sub-ruler: Mars
Adventurous warrior. Bold, blunt, ready to move.
- Decan 3Days 21–30Sub-ruler: Sun
Visionary leader. Inspires others toward a bigger horizon.
